Important Safety Information
This device is a high-density electronic product; please do not attempt to
open it yourself
Ensure the device is protected against shocks at all times as this may
cause serious damage
Do not shake the device violently as this may cause the LCD screen to
malfunction
Do not use damaged adapters, plugs or sockets
Do not bend or damage the power adapter
3
Do not touch the adapter with wet hands or disconnect using the power
cable
Avoid using the device in extremely high or low temperatures and humid
or dusty environments
Do not place the device near any naked flame source, such as lighted
candle etc
In order to clean the product, please use a moist cloth to gently wipe the
screen. Do not use alcohol, thinners or petrol to clean the Tablet screen
Please use only the supplier power adapter and cables, the use of any
other charger may be dangerous
Excessive volume on the earphones may cause permanent damage to
hearing
Please charge the device when
(1) The power icon shows the battery is low
(2) The Tablet turns itself off suddenly, even if restarted again
(3) There is no response when operating any button
Do not disconnect the device from the PC during downloads, uploads or
formatting as this may cause programming error
Touchscreen Precautions
To get best use of the Tablet touchscreen, remove the pre-applied screen
protector before using the device.
To avoid scratching the device, please do not use sharp tools or objects on the
touchscreen.
The capacitive touchscreen detects small electrical charges released by the
human body. For best performance, tap the touchscreen with your fingertip.

1. Getting Started
1.1 Charging the battery
The Time2Touch Tablet PC comes with a built-in lithium battery. Please fully
charge the device before using for the first time using only the provided charger
the Tablet can also be charged via the USB cable using a PC or other USB
charging source.
Warning: using unauthorised chargers may cause damage to the battery.
1.2 Charging via the charging adapter
1. Plug the charger into the wall socket
2. Connect the charger to the Tablet via the charging port
1.3 Charging via USB
1. Connect the USB cable to the micro USB port
2. Plug the USB cable into a USB power source (power adapter, PC, laptop etc)
When the Tablet is charging, the battery symbol on the top
right hand corner of the device will show a charging symbol.
Once the battery is fully charged and the lightning symbol has disappeared from
the battery icon, unplug the device from the charger/USB cable.
Please note: we do not advise customers to use the Tablet whilst charging as
it could slow down charging. Whilst the Tablet is on charge, the touch screen may
not function correctly - In this case, unplug the device from the charger to use.
Whilst charging, the device may get warm, this is normal and should not affect
your Tablet lifespan or performance.
If your Tablet is not charging properly, please contact Customer Services
Any damage caused by misuse of the charger or cables is not covered by
the warranty.
6
1.4 Startup / Shutdown / Sleep Mode
Press and hold the power button for 5 seconds to boot up the Time2Touch
Tablet PC. Once it has loaded, the lock screen will be shown.
To unlock the Tablet, drag the
‘locked’ symbol to the right until it
becomes an ‘unlocked’ symbol. You
will now be at the desktop page.
7
Press and hold the power button down until the ‘Power off’ list appears on the
desktop. Click ‘Power off’ then ‘OK’ to turn the device off.
You are able to put the Tablet into ‘sleep mode’ by simply pressing the Power
Button once. The screen will turn itself off but can be awoken again anytime by
pressing the Power Button again.
When the Tablet is not in use, this feature can be used to preserve battery life.

2. System Settings
Click the Settings icon on the homepage to bring up the list of system settings.
Simply click onto the setting you would like to access.
2.1 Wireless & Networks
Connecting to the Wi-Fi allows you to access the internet from anywhere within
your Wireless router range.
To enable Wi-Fi:
1. Slide the Wi-Fi tab to the right to turn on
2. Once the Wi-Fi has been turned on, the device will scan for any available
Wi-Fi networks these will be displayed on the right.
3. Click on the network you would like to connect to you will be prompted to
enter a password. This is your wireless router key, please ensure the
password is entered correctly or the device will not connect to the Wi-Fi
13
Once the password has been entered, press ‘Connect’. When the
device has successfully connected to the router, a full Wi-Fi signal
will be seen on the status bar.
If the Tablet has been connected to a Wireless router previously, it will
automatically reconnect when within the network range.
Please note: In order to preserve battery life, turn off the Wi-Fi when the device
is not in use.
2.2 Bluetooth
Using the Bluetooth function, you are able to connect to accessories such as
keyboards, speakers or headsets without using cables or connectors.
To connect to a Bluetooth device:
1. Enable the Bluetooth function by
sliding the tab to the right
14
2. Once the Bluetooth has been turned on, the device will scan for any
available Bluetooth devices these will be displayed on the right.
3. Click on the Bluetooth
device you would like to
connect to you may be
prompted to enter a code
to complete the pairing.
Once the code has been entered and the device has successfully paired to the
Bluetooth device, it will be shows as ‘connected’.
Please note: In order to preserve battery life, turn off the Bluetooth function
when the device is not in use.
15
2.3 Sound
The Sound settings allows you to change the volume, touch sounds and
notification sounds on the Time2Touch Tablet PC.
Volumes
This allows you to change the default volume settings on the Tablet for music,
video, games & other media, notifications and alarms.
Default notification
Select a sound from the list provided to change the default notification sound.
Touch sounds
Enable or disable the sound caused by selecting an icon on the touchscreen.
Screen lock sounds
Enable or disable the sound caused by locking/unlocking the screen.
16
2.4 Display
The Display settings allows you to change the brightness, wallpaper and font
size on the Time2Touch Tablet PC.
Brightness
This allows you to adjust the brightness of the Tablet screen
Wallpaper
Change the desktop wallpaper to images from the Gallery or preinstalled
wallpapers
Sleep
Set the time period before the Tablet screen enters sleep mode from 15 seconds
to 30 minutes
Daydream
Add a screensaver to the Tablet that appears while the device is on charge
Font size
Enlarge or reduce font size to allow easier reading of text
